#f962c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f962c2 is composed of 97.6% red, 38.4%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.6% magenta, 22.1%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 321.9 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 68%. #f962c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c4ff with #f30085.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#f962c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f962c2 has RGB values of R:249, G:98,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.22,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16343746.

Shades and Tints of #f962c2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0008 is the darkest color, while #fff9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f962c2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aeadae is the less saturated color, while #f962c2 is the most saturated one.
